  • I'm not tottaly sure but I think the Buzz seat is like the seat on my Bugaboo and doesn't recline so much as pivot (if that makes sense) If that is the case then I think the carrycot would definately be better for a new born as their legs would stick up in the seat. I think it depends how much you will use it. If you are going to walk alot then I would go for the carry cot but if you will only use it for short trips then the car seat might be a better option. We have the Maxi cosi infant carrier (cabriofix) and it is absoultely fantastic.

    I have not bothered with the Dreami Carricot at all. Personally it seemed a waste of money and thought that if I needed it after the baby arrived I would buy one then. I didn't need one and so haven't bothered.
    I did think I might get one instead of a Moses basket but when I went off to Mothercare to investigate I found it really heavy - and that was without the baby in it!!!!
    I use my Maxi Cosi car seat to transport my LO about at the moment as it's so convenient to put it onto the Buzz. But now the weather is brightening up a bit (she says, Jinxing things!) I have just got the pushchair bit out the garage to try it. I wish I had realised how much it reclined because I would have used it sooner, it is practically flat and can be used from birth.

  • I have it too and love it! All I would say is the carrycot part is very expensive and very narrow inside. I used it as a carry cot and also to take lo out for walks in. I bought mine separate from the Buzz itself, I got it 2nd hand on e bay for the bargain price of ??60! It was still like new as the baby that had it first didn't like lying down and had only used it 2 or 3 times. I only used it for 2 months or so cos Poppy hated not being able to wave her arms about (too thin inside!) so it went back on e bay and I got ??30 for it!
    I would definately recommend buying used from ebay then selling it on - it will save you a fortune and all that money saved can buy something else you really want!
